Solution for 4x+13=10x-21 equation:


Simplifying
4x + 13 = 10x + -21

Reorder the terms:
13 + 4x = 10x + -21

Reorder the terms:
13 + 4x = -21 + 10x

Solving
13 + 4x = -21 + 10x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-10x' to each side of the equation.
13 + 4x + -10x = -21 + 10x + -10x

Combine like terms: 4x + -10x = -6x
13 + -6x = -21 + 10x + -10x

Combine like terms: 10x + -10x = 0
13 + -6x = -21 + 0
13 + -6x = -21

Add '-13' to each side of the equation.
13 + -13 + -6x = -21 + -13

Combine like terms: 13 + -13 = 0
0 + -6x = -21 + -13
-6x = -21 + -13

Combine like terms: -21 + -13 = -34
-6x = -34

Divide each side by '-6'.
x = 5.666666667

Simplifying
x = 5.666666667
